Peppermint bark is a perfect holiday treat to share with the family this season! Our delicious homemade bark recipe is simple to prepare and can be adjusted to make big batches with ease!
1bagLight or Dark Cocoa Candy Melts Candy1 bag = 12 oz.
5tablespoonPeppermint Crunch Candies, divided
1bagWhite or Bright White Candy Melts Candy1 bag = 12 oz.
Instructions
Grab a microwave-safe bowl and use it to melt your chosen flavor of cocoa Candy Melts Candy according to the package instructions. Once melted, add 2 tablespoons of Peppermint Crunch Candies and stir till thoroughly mixed.
Pour the combined mixture into a nonstick 13 x 9 in. pan or cookie sheet. Use an angled spatula to make sure the mixture is spread smoothly and evenly across the pan or sheet.
Chill the entire pan or sheet in the refrigerator until it's set (about 5 to 10 minutes).
While the cocoa candy sheet sets in the refrigerator, use a microwave-safe bowl to melt the White or Bright White Candy Melts Candy according to package instructions.
When melted, add 2 tablespoons of Peppermint Crunch Candies and stir till it's thoroughly mixed.
Once the cocoa sheet has set completely, remove it from the refrigerator and add the second layer of melted Candy Melts Candy and Peppermint Crunch candies to it.
Smooth out new layer using an angled spatula and then return the pan or sheet to the refrigerator to chill until it's set. This should take another 5 to 10 minutes.
Once the combined sheet has set completely, remove it from the refrigerator.
Finally, break your bark into whatever sized pieces you'd like and serve them!
